My Students

Learning is more than just a simple cookie-cutter formula that can be implemented and applied to all students, and that includes students from minority groups, students with disabilities, and those who are economically disadvantaged. Hands-on learning experiences are at the forefront of what engages these students the most.

School data on US News shows 76% of our students are economically disadvantaged.

My class also includes 52% of students who are English language learners, as well as a number of students who receive special education services. Our classroom is a diverse setting where learning can take any shape and form, based on their individual strengths and challenges.

My Project

Imagine yourself time-traveling back to when you were an elementary school student. "The simpler times," is what is often said. I know I've thought this. I also know my parents and grandparents uttered the same comments. However, as a 21st-century elementary school student, are these really "simpler times?"

My goal is to bring STEAM and other integral 21st century skills to life.

What is STEAM? It represents the academic content areas of: science, technology, engineering, art, and math. We are living in a technologically advanced and fast-paced world, and it's time that the classroom can keep up with that. A 3D printer, something that once seemed impossible, is real and accessible to these students today.

With a 3D printer, students will engage in coding and lessons that focus on the Engineering Design Process and collaborative learning. Not only that, but students will also have finished products that they can physically use in class, such as math manipulatives, as well as figures for dioramas and other projects. Students will even have the opportunity to take their creations home as keepsakes. Perhaps above all else, students will have memories of using "that cool machine thing" that will last a lifetime.
